HIMES, SHIRLEYANNE, 83, of Calais, died peacefully at her home March 21, after a brief illness. She was born May 24, 1930, in Brooklyn, N.Y., the daughter of Olaf Johnson and Charlotte (Acherman) Johnson. ShirleyAnne attended schools in Oceanside, Long Island, N.Y., and received a master’s degree in education from Johnson State College. She was married to Ralph E. Himes Feb. 19, 1949, in Oceanside, N.Y. ShirleyAnne was a longtime teacher at the former St. Michael’s Graded School in Montpelier, where she taught kindergarten and first grade, from 1967 to 2002. She was a member of St. Augustine Church, also in Montpelier. She is survived by her daughter, Deborah Craig, and husband, Jeffrey; and her son, David Himes, and wife, Gina, all of Woodbury; four grandchildren; four great-grandchildren; former son-in-law Thomas Leno and his wife, Becky. ShirleyAnne was predeceased by her husband, Ralph, who died Nov. 7, 1993; and her sister, Cecilia Dojohn, who died April 28, 1995. There will be no calling hours. A funeral Mass will be celebrated at 1pm Saturday, April 5, at St. Augustine Catholic Church, Montpelier.
